#fetch_mirrors(options) ⇒ Boolean
Retrieve upstream source file from a mirror, by randomly iterating through #mirrors until there’s no more mirrors left. Will #warn if the mirror’s URI cannot be resolved or if the URI cannot be retrieved. Does not suppress any errors from Vanagon::Component::Source.
257 258 259 260 261 262 263 264 265 266 267 268 269 270 271 272 273 274 275 |
# File 'lib/vanagon/component.rb', line 257 def fetch_mirrors() mirrors.to_a.shuffle.each do |mirror| begin VanagonLogger.info %(Attempting to fetch from mirror URL "#{mirror}") @source = Vanagon::Component::Source.source(mirror, **) return true if source.fetch rescue SocketError # SocketError means that there was no DNS/name resolution # for whatever remote protocol the mirror tried to use. VanagonLogger.error %(Unable to resolve mirror URL "#{mirror}") rescue RuntimeError # Source retrieval does not consistently return a meaningful # namespaced error message, which means we're brute-force rescuing # RuntimeError. Not a good look, and we should fix this. VanagonLogger.error %(Unable to retrieve mirror URL "#{mirror}") end end false end |

#force_version ⇒ Object
Force version determination for components
If the component doesn’t already have a version set (which normally happens for git sources), the source will be fetched into a temporary directory to attempt to figure out the version if the source type supports :version. This directory will be cleaned once the get_sources method returns
396 397 398 399 400 401 402 403 404 |
# File 'lib/vanagon/component.rb', line 396 def force_version if @version.nil? Dir.mktmpdir do |dir| get_source(dir) end end raise Vanagon::Error, "Unable to determine source version for component #{@name}!" if @version.nil? @version end |

#get_source(workdir) ⇒ Object
Fetches the primary source for the component. As a side effect, also sets @extract_with, @dirname and @version for the component for use in the makefile template
306 307 308 309 310 311 312 313 314 315 316 317 318 319 320 321 322 323 324 325 326 327 328 329 330 331 332 333 |
# File 'lib/vanagon/component.rb', line 306 def get_source(workdir) # rubocop:disable Metrics/AbcSize, Metrics/PerceivedComplexity opts = .merge({ workdir: workdir, dirname: dirname }) if url || !mirrors.empty? if ENV['VANAGON_USE_MIRRORS'] == 'n' or ENV['VANAGON_USE_MIRRORS'] == 'false' fetch_url(opts) else fetch_mirrors(opts) || fetch_url(opts) end source.verify extract_with << source.extract(platform.tar) if source.respond_to? :extract @cleanup_source = source.cleanup if source.respond_to?(:cleanup) @dirname ||= source.dirname # Git based sources probably won't set the version, so we load it if it hasn't been already set if source.respond_to?(:version) @version ||= source.version end else VanagonLogger.info "No source given for component '#{@name}'" # If there is no source, we don't want to try to change directories, so we just change to the current directory. @dirname = './' # If there is no source, there is nothing to do to extract extract_with << ': no source, so nothing to extract' end end |
